- Spindle
Spindle is a niche strategy and communications consultancy focused on the life sciences sector. The company works primarily with academic institutions, hospitals, start-ups, as well as government agencies and not-for-profits to help advance high-stakes research-driven initiatives. Spindle’s core services include business planning and strategic planning, capital sourcing, opportunity assessment and business case development, as well as evaluation of programs and organizations in the research and science realm.

- BioBenefits
BioBenefits specializes in employee benefit plans for life science and related companies. Launched in 2017, BioBenefits offers access to a national pool of bio-employers, helping plan sponsors spread their employee health risk across similar employee groups – making for more affordable and flexible plan options. The BioBenefits Program delivers a needs-based approach that focuses on plan design scope – driving sustainability, and delivering a competitive suite of both traditional and non-traditional benefits for employers and employees.
